If you have asthma, smoking is especially risky because of the damage it does to the lungs. Smoke irritates the airways, making them swollen, narrow, and filled with sticky mucus — the same things that happen …

Impact. … does hosta have flowersWebTobacco smoke—including secondhand smoke—is unhealthy for everyone, especially people with asthma. 3, 6 Secondhand smoke is a mixture of gases and fine particles that … does hosting a server use bandwidthWebSecondhand smoke can trigger an asthma attack in a child. Children with asthma who are around secondhand smoke have worse and frequent asthma attacks. More than 40 percent of children who go to the emergency room for asthma live with smokers.
